【揭秘Kali Linux NetHunter】高效网络扫描实战技巧大公开
引言
Kali Linux NetHunter是一款基于Kali Linux的Android渗透测试平台,专为移动设备设计。它集成了多种网络扫描工具,使得网络安全专业人士能够方便地在移动设备上进行网络渗透测试。本文将详细介绍Kali Linux NetHunter的网络扫描功能及其实战技巧。
Kali Linux NetHunter概述
Kali Linux NetHunter提供了以下特点:
- 支持多种设备:NetHunter支持多种Android设备,包括Nexus系列、某些OnePlus设备以及一些自定义设备。
- 强大的工具集:NetHunter集成了Kali Linux的所有网络安全工具,包括Nmap、Wireshark、Aircrack-ng等。
- 图形界面和命令行:NetHunter提供了图形界面和命令行接口,方便用户使用。
- 自定义ROM:NetHunter提供了一个可定制的ROM,允许用户根据自己的需求进行修改。
网络扫描实战技巧
1. 无线网络扫描
工具:Airodump-ng
使用场景:扫描附近的无线网络,获取SSID、BSSID、信道、加密类型等信息。
命令示例:
airodump-ng wlan0mon
实战技巧:
- 使用
-c
选项指定信道,例如:airodump-ng -c 6 wlan0mon
- 使用
-b
选项指定BSSID,例如:airodump-ng -b <BSSID> wlan0mon
2. 端口扫描
工具:Nmap
使用场景:扫描目标主机的开放端口和服务。
命令示例:
nmap <目标IP>
实战技巧:
- 使用
-p
选项指定端口范围,例如:nmap -p 1-1000 <目标IP>
- 使用
-sV
选项进行版本检测,例如:nmap -sV <目标IP>
3. 漏洞扫描
工具:Metasploit
使用场景:检测目标系统上的漏洞。
命令示例:
msfconsole
use auxiliary/scanner/portscan/tcp
set rhost <目标IP>
set rport <端口>
run
实战技巧:
- 使用Metasploit的模块进行特定的漏洞检测,例如:
use auxiliary/gather/smb_version
- 使用Metasploit的payload进行漏洞利用。
4. 网络流量监控
工具:Wireshark
使用场景:捕获和分析网络流量。
命令示例:
sudo wireshark -i wlan0mon
实战技巧:
- 使用过滤器筛选特定的数据包,例如:
ip.addr == <目标IP>
- 使用统计信息分析流量特征。
总结
Kali Linux NetHunter是一款功能强大的移动渗透测试平台,提供了丰富的网络扫描工具和实战技巧。通过本文的介绍,您可以了解到NetHunter的基本功能和如何进行高效的网络扫描。在实际操作中,结合具体场景和需求,灵活运用这些技巧,能够帮助您更好地发现网络中的安全漏洞。